Layer 2 Scaling Solutions

Layer 2 scaling solutions are designed to augment the capabilities of the basic layer 1 blockchain, which is often limited in terms of transaction capacity and speed. Layer 2 solutions use novel techniques and protocols to improve scalability and efficiency, often by offloading transactions to separate layers of the blockchain. Some of the most prominent layer 2 scaling solutions include state channels, sidechains, and decentralized exchange (DEX) protocols.

State Channels: State channels enable users to establish private, off-chain transaction channels, allowing for faster and more efficient transactions. By reducing the need for on-chain confirmation, state channels can significantly improve transaction throughput and reduce latency. However, state channels also come with potential risks, such as the risk of fork and the need for secure channel establishment and maintenance.

Sidechains: Sidechains are designed to augment the main blockchain by allowing for off-chain transactions that are synchronized with the main chain. This approach offers significant scalability benefits, as transactions can be processed independently of the main chain, reducing load on the main blockchain. Sidechains can also be designed to be secure, ensuring that transactions are protected from compromise.

Potential Applications

Layer 2 scaling solutions have the potential to play a significant role in addressing climate change by enabling more sustainable and efficient transactions. Some potential applications include:

1. Carbon Markets: Layer 2 scaling solutions can help create more efficient and transparent carbon markets, enabling businesses and individuals to purchase and sell carbon credits in a secure and cost-effective manner. This can help encourage the adoption of carbon reduction measures and support the development of renewable energy projects.

2. Supply Chain Tracking: Layer 2 solutions can enable more efficient and traceable supply chain management, allowing businesses to monitor their supply chain operations and reduce their environmental impact. By using blockchain technology, businesses can gain transparency into their supply chain operations, reducing the risk of pollution and waste.

3. Smart Energy Grids: Layer 2 scaling solutions can enable more efficient and sustainable energy grids, allowing for better management of renewable energy sources and the integration of energy storage systems. By automating energy transactions and optimizing energy usage, smart energy grids can help reduce greenhouse gas emissions and support the transition to a more sustainable energy system.
